MIL-DTL-17111 - Hydraulic Transmission Fluid
We perform lubricants testing by Military Specification MIL-DTL-17111, which covers a hydraulic transmission fluid used in systems involving mechanical or fibrous filters or centrifugal purification. This military specification covers a class of hydraulic transmission fluid that consists of mineral oil products and approved additive materials. This class of hydraulic transmission fluid is required to be noncorrosive to bearings and hydraulic systems and hydraulic systems. It is also required to not cause clogging of oil screens or valves.

The following is a list of tests required by Specification MIL-DTL-17111. Some of these tests are customized for this exact specification. - ASTM D974 - Acid/Base Number
- ASTM D611 - Aniline Point
- ASTM D91 - Precipitation Number
- ASTM D445 - Kinematic Viscosity
- ASTM D97 - Pour Point
- ASTM D92 - Flash & Fire Point
- ASTM D95 - Water by Distillation
- ASTM D1500 - Color Analysis
- ASTM D5621 - Shear Stability of Hydraulic Fluids
- ASTM D2266 - Four Ball Lubricity
- ASTM D972 - Evaporative Loss
- MIL-DTL-17111 §4.5.3.1 - Aniline Point Change Test
- MIL-DTL-17111 §4.5.3.2 - Low Temperature Turbidity Test
- ASTM D665 - Corrosion Protection (Modified per Specification)
- MIL-DTL-17111 §4.5.3.4.1 - Corrosion & Oxidation Test
- MIL-DTL-17111 §4.5.3.4.2 - Corrosion & Oxidation Test
- MIL-DTL-17111 §4.5.3.5 - Water Sludging Test
